Garlic Butter Steak and Potatoes Skillet is a bold, savory one-pan meal with juicy steak bites, golden potatoes, and a rich garlic herb butter sauce. Fast, satisfying, and perfect for any night.
1½ lbs sirloin or ribeye steak, cut into cubes
1½ lbs baby potatoes, halved
1 tbsp olive oil (plus more if needed)
3 tbsp unsalted butter
4–5 garlic cloves, minced
1 tsp chopped fresh rosemary
1 tsp chopped fresh thyme
Salt and pepper, to taste
Optional: chopped parsley, lemon juice
Boil potatoes 6–7 min until just tender. Drain and pat dry.
Heat 1 tbsp oil in skillet. Sear potatoes cut-side down 5–7 min until golden. Remove.
Pat steak dry and season. Sear in batches 2–3 min per side. Remove.
Reduce heat. Add butter, garlic, rosemary, and thyme. Sauté 30 sec.
Return steak and potatoes to skillet. Toss to coat in garlic butter.
Cook 1–2 min until heated through. Garnish and serve hot.
Use a cast-iron skillet for best sear. Don’t overcook garlic. Add lemon or broth to deglaze if needed.
